Since it is the same venue (with a new name), I'm sure they will end up booking the same number as last year.

Quote:

Originally Posted by compwiztobe (Post 1391193)
Regionals usually start with a low cap and raise it later in the registration timetable, to reserve spots for rookies, local teams, etc. This cap will likely go up at a later date.

Quote:

Originally Posted by Billfred (Post 1391202)
This. Palmetto is listed with capacity at 54; last year, we had 67.
